POSITION SUMMARY:

A Project Manager I in the Information Services department is responsible for the coordination and successful execution of technology-based projects, managing all fundamental aspects including scope, budget, and schedule. This role requires regular monitoring and reporting on project progress, and effective relationship management with team members and cross-departmental stakeholders. The Project Manager I should be familiar with both traditional (Waterfall) and modern (Agile) project management methodologies.

P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ES:

Oversee the execution of IS application development and infrastructure projects, ensuring timely completion within budget constraints under the guidance of senior project management personnel.

Collaborate with stakeholders to define project scope and objectives clearly.

Develop and maintain a detailed project plan to track and monitor progress effectively.

Manage financial aspects of the project, including budget preparation and cost tracking.

Provide regular updates to stakeholders, maintaining transparent communication regarding project status.

Implement change management processes to adjust project scope, schedule, and costs as needed.

Maintain comprehensive project documentation throughout the project lifecycle.

Support requirements management and stakeholder engagement to ensure project alignment with business needs.

Independently coordinate with IS management teams to address resource allocation and scheduling challenges.

Facilitate project meetings, ensuring effective minute taking and action item tracking.

Deliver project status reports to both IS Management and business stakeholders.

POSITION REQUIREMENTS:

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or a related field, or equivalent practical experience.

Minimum 1 year of experience in I.S. Project Management.

Minimum 2 years of experience in Information Systems.

Formal training in project management or a recognized project management certification is required.

Experience with collaboration and project management tools such Jira, Confluence, BigPicture, Custom Charts, Webex is preferred.

Strong working knowledge of Microsoft Office applications.

Comprehensive understanding of various software development life cycle (SDLC) methodologies.

Basic skills in requirements management and elicitation.

Outgoing, confident, and comfortable communicating with all levels of management.

Excellent verbal and written communication skills.

Solid organizational skills, including attention to detail and multitasking abilities.

Ability to work independently and collaborate effectively in team settings.

Availability to work extra hours, including evenings and weekends, as required.

Legal eligibility to work in the United States without sponsorship.
